High Performance Drupal (O'Reilly)
Thursday, 20 February 2014

Covering Drupal versions 7 and 8, this comprehensive guide provides best practices, examples, and in-depth explanations for solving several performance and scalability issues. Learn how to apply coding and infrastructure techniques to Drupal internals, application performance, databases, web servers, and performance analysis.
